Robustness fixes in test suite machinery. Added a module-level INSTALLED flag, which can be set to false if the test suite is being run in-place (without ipython having been installed at all). This is because how we call and import things must be done differently depending on whether the code is installed or is being run in-place. The only ones that can know this reliably are the entry-point scripts, so those are responsible for setting this flag. Also made the code that validates ipython in subprocesses report errors better, by checking stderr for errors before validating stdout output, as anything on stderr will be likely informative of the real problem.

"""
This module is *completely* deprecated and should no longer be used for
any purpose. Currently, we have a few parts of the core that have
not been componentized and thus, still rely on this module. When everything
has been made into a component, this module will be sent to deathrow.
"""

def get():
"""Get the most recently created InteractiveShell instance."""
from IPython.core.iplib import InteractiveShell
insts = InteractiveShell.get_instances()
if len(insts)==0:
return None
most_recent = insts[0]
for inst in insts[1:]:
if inst.created > most_recent.created:
most_recent = inst
return most_recent
